Do you know what dates in February they are there
All of February,but it will be less as the Month goes on.

It will be almost all Argentina Tour Groups-Brazil goes off Summer Break at the end of January,while Argentina's Summer Break ends at the end of February.

So don't worry about leraning Portuguese-just concentrate on Spanish!lol:)
